  • Page 15 1 Safety / 1.6 Deflagration on gas engines Deflagration on gas engines Low-pressure stages from ABB Turbo Systems can tolerate a deflagration with a transient pressure increase of 12 bar (guideline value). High-pressure stages from ABB Turbo Systems can tolerate a deflagration with a transient pressure increase of 15 bar (guideline value).

  • Page 64 Compressor cleaning We recommend cleaning the HP compressor after the LP compressor. On V-engines with several low-pressure and/or high-pressure stages per engine, ABB Tur- bocharging recommends the parallel cleaning of the LP compressors as well as the parallel cleaning of the HP compressors.
  • Page 65 Periodic cleaning of the compressor during operation prevents or delays any great increase in the contamination, but never replaces the regular service work where the low and high- pressure stages are completely dismantled and the compressors are mechanically cleaned. © Copyright 2020 ABB.   • Page 68 ABB Turbocharging recommends using fuels with a mass ratio of vanadium to sodium of less than 3:1 so that the melting temperature of the sodium vanadyl vanadate is as high as possible.

Sporadic surge blows Surging of the low-pressure stage can occur during certain operating states, such as when reducing the engine performance quickly when manoeuvring.

  • Page 87: Disposing Of Low-Pressure And High-Pressure Stage Components

    Damaged thermal insulation can lead to dust exposure. The glass fibres can cause mechanical irritation of the eyes, skin, and respiratory tracts. The enginebuilder's instructions must be followed for the handling and disposal of the thermal insulation. © Copyright 2020 ABB. All rights reserved. HZTL4061_EN Rev.D March 2020...
